Title of article :
Ring-opening polymerization of l-lactide catalyzed by a biocompatible calcium complex

Abstract :
A novel calcium complex, [(DAIP)2Ca]2 (where DAIP-H = 2-[(2-dimethylamino-ethylimino)methyl]phenol), is prepared in a one flask reaction by condensation of Ca(OMe)2 with DAIP-H in toluene/THF. Experimental results show that in the presence of various alcohols, [(DAIP)2Ca]2 efficiently initiates the ring-opening polymerization of l-lactide in a controlled fashion, yielding polymers with expectative molecular weight and low polydispersity indexes. Furthermore, kinetic studies show a first-order dependency on both [LA] and [BnOH].
